I own stock in Wal-Mart de Mexico. I have no 1099 DIV from this company but my broker claims I received $338.00 in DIV. How do I report on my1040 without a 1099 DIV ?

All you can do here is enter the dividend "as if" you DID receive a 1099-DIV.  You might want to ask your broker about how much of this is "qualified dividends".  Don't worry about "but I didn't receive a 1099-DIV!"  If you look at Schedule B itself - https://www.irs.gov/pub/irs-pdf/f1040sb.pdf - you'll see there's no reference to "1099-DIV" there at all.  Simply payer's name and amount.
